Efforts to put out a wildfire near the Canadian town of Churchill Falls continue as of Thursday (May 29).
The fire has reportedly spread across about 170 hectares, just 1 kilometre east of Churchill Falls.

00:00Efforts to put out a wildfire near the Canadian town of Churchill Falls continue as of Thursday.
00:06Crews and two water bombers have been deployed to contain the blaze, which is burning just one kilometer east of the town.
00:13The fire has so far spread across roughly 170 hectares.
00:17Residents have been urged to stay alert, as forest fire season has started early in Newfoundland and Labrador.
00:23The Forestry Department's Wildfire Program Director, Craig Cody, said the risk to Churchill Falls is decreasing, but the fire remains out of control due to dry weather.
00:34Meanwhile in Manitoba, a state of emergency was declared on Wednesday.
00:39Thousands in the northern and eastern parts of the province have been told to evacuate, as wildfires continue to spread across central and western Canada.
00:48Fire crews remain on high alert, with dry weather expected to continue in the coming days.
